这可能很简单,但我是新手,我需要帮助! 如果我发出一个Ajax请求,当成功用其他数据替换DOM的一部分时,如何使新数据可以访问jQuery?
答案 0 :(得分:1)
数据将在您传递给回调函数
的参数中可用$.ajax( {
type:'Get',
url:'http://mysite.com/mywebservice',
sucess:function(data) {
alert(data);
}
})
您还可以使用Ajax简写get
$.get('http://mysite.com/mywebservice', function (data) {
alert(data);
});
如果你的意思是在将数据注入DOM之后如何访问数据,那么它将自动被访问,因为它成为DOM的一部分。
答案 1 :(得分:0)
在您提供给ajax请求的回调函数中,您将可以访问数据。从那里你可以用它替换部分DOM和/或将它存储在其他地方(全局变量等)。
答案 2 :(得分:0)
当然,替换区域中的元素没有绑定事件处理程序,除非您使用jquery 1.3的新live()事件。